If it's a modern card encapsulated and labelled by the manufacturer there is really no benefit to having it graded. Grading serves 2 distinct purposes, authentication and condition. If it's an encapsulated vintage (buyback) card then grading may increase its value. Sharing more info with us would be helpful.
